Attribution modelsBayesian statisticsFrequently asked questionsMetrics overviewUser journey trackingHow to save and load presets
You can save dashboard and performance views as presets. A preset includes all of the settings of your performance report, including the selected attribution model, time frame, filters, and sorting. Presets can be visible to you only or also to your teammates.
We also added some global presets that you might want to check out.
Loading presets
To load a preset, click Presets at the upper right-hand side of the window, select the preset you want to load from the list, and click Open.
Saving presets
To store the current view as a preset, open Presets and click Add current view as preset.
Enter a name, select the visibility (Team or Private) and choose between Static and Relative time frames. A relative time frame will be dynamically changing every time the preset is loaded: E.g. if you report on last week's data it will always load last week as a time frame when set to Relative time frame.
Editing and deleting presets
Select the preset you want to change and click Edit or Delete.
